"No," said I; "but if you care-" "No use," said he; "when he has made up his mind you might as well be talking to a milestone." "And you must be off to-morrow?" said I, consulting the bishop's letter. "Yes," said he, "short shrift." "And who am I getting?" I wondered. "Hard to guess," said he. He was in no humor for conversation. The following week, that most melancholy of processions, a curate's furniture en route, filed slowly through the village, and out along the highroad, that led through bog and fen, and by lake borders to the town of N--.
